Valencia and Southeast Spain Brace Against Extreme Weather Event

Valencia and surrounding regions faced extreme weather as a DANA (an intense meteorological phenomenon) hit southeastern Spain, prompting a red alert until midnight Wednesday. While the intensity was less severe than previous occurrences, cities like Tarragona and Malaga experienced significant flooding, disrupting daily life. Local governments implemented timely alerts, leading to effective emergency responses that helped mitigate the impact. Schools remained closed, villages were evacuated, and train services were suspended. The aftermath prompted scrutiny of previous governmental response delays, particularly in Valencia, where a recent storm had devastating consequences.
